Why These Are the Top Mazda Repair Auto Repair Shops in Atlantic Highlands

** The Mazda repair market in the Atlantic Highlands area is characterized by a reliance on the surrounding Monmouth County and broader Central NJ region. Atlantic Highlands itself lacks a dedicated Mazda-only specialist, creating a market where residents choose between the **convenience and factory-backed expertise of the local dealership (Ocean Mazda)** and the **highly-rated, cost-effective independent specialists in nearby towns (JAP Auto Tech)**. **Competition Level:** Moderate. While there are numerous general auto repair shops, true specialists with documented expertise in Mazda's specific technologies (Skyactiv, i-ACTIV, infotainment) are limited. This elevates the reputation and demand for the top-tier providers listed. **Average Quality:** The quality of service for Mazda owners is generally high, provided they select a proven specialist. General mechanics may lack the specific diagnostic software and training for Mazda's complex systems, leading to a noticeable performance gap between a top-3 shop and an average one.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ing follows a standard tiered structure: * **Dealership (Ocean Mazda):** Highest labor rates ($150-$180/hr), plus premium for OEM parts. Justified for warranty and highly complex computer/software issues. * **Independent Specialists (JAP Auto Tech, R/T Tuning):** Lower labor rates ($110-$140/hr), often using high-quality aftermarket parts, resulting in significant savings for routine and mechanical repairs. R/T Tuning's performance work commands a premium. For an Atlantic Highlands resident, the choice often comes down to the specific service needed: dealership for warranty and electronics, a local independent for expert mechanical service, and a dedicated performance shop for enthusiast vehicles.

What are the most common Mazda repair issues for drivers in Atlantic Highlands, NJ?

Due to our coastal climate and proximity to salty air, Mazda owners here frequently need attention for brake corrosion and suspension components. Models like the CX-5 and Mazda3 also commonly require services for infotainment system glitches and addressing minor oil leaks from the valve cover gasket.

Are repair costs for Mazdas higher at the local dealership versus an independent shop in Atlantic Highlands?

Typically, the dealership in nearby Hazlet or Shrewsbury will have higher labor rates and OEM part costs. A trusted independent shop in Atlantic Highlands can often provide the same quality service using OEM or equivalent parts at a more competitive price, especially for routine maintenance and common repairs.

What local factors in Atlantic Highlands should influence my Mazda's maintenance schedule?

The salty sea air accelerates corrosion, making undercarriage washes and more frequent brake inspections essential. Additionally, the mix of stop-and-go traffic on local roads and highway driving means adhering strictly to transmission fluid and engine air filter change intervals is important for longevity.
